Overview: Elevating the Flight Simulation Experience
Microsoft Flight Simulator (2020) Premium Deluxe 40th Anniversary Edition for Windows stands as a pinnacle of realism and immersion, allowing aviation enthusiasts and casual explorers alike to soar through meticulously rendered global landscapes. Developed by Xbox Game Studios, this masterpiece captures the essence of flight with precision and depth, making it a must-have for anyone eager to explore the skies from the comfort of their PC.
Core Highlights: What Makes It Stand Out
- Unparalleled Realism in Graphics and Physics: Leveraging satellite data and Azure AI, the simulator offers breathtakingly accurate visuals and authentic flight mechanics.
- Comprehensive Global Coverage: Explore over 37,000 airports and fly across every continent, from the icy peaks of the Alps to the glowing cities of Asia.
- Dynamic Weather System & Day-Night Cycles: Experience ever-changing weather conditions and lighting that adapt seamlessly in real-time, enhancing immersion.
- Learning and Simulation Depth: Its realistic cockpit instruments and procedural tutorials help both beginners and seasoned pilots hone their skills practically.

Handling and Realism: How Close Is It to the Real Thing?
Flying within this simulator feels akin to piloting a real aircraft—an impressive feat achieved through advanced physics modeling. Control responses are precise; the plane reacts to wind gusts, turbulence, and altitude variations much like a real aircraft would. For those keen to translate virtual skills into real-world knowledge, the simulator provides a noteworthy bridge with its faithful replication of cockpit instruments, navigation systems, and emergency procedures. Beginners may find the learning curve gentle with its step-by-step tutorials, while veterans will appreciate the depth of mechanics that can be fine-tuned for a truly challenging experience.
Unique Features and Competitive Edges
While many flight sims stake their claim on realism, Microsoft Flight Simulator distinguishes itself notably with its combination of graphical fidelity and environmental responsiveness. The integration of satellite data and AI-driven terrain modeling means your virtual journey reflects real-world geography in astonishing detail, from the rugged Rockies to bustling metropolises. Additionally, the simulator's weather system isn't just cosmetic—it influences flight physics, making each session dynamically different and more authentic. These features elevate Flight Simulator from a game to a powerful educational and training platform, offering a depth of experience that few competitors can match.
Comparison with Other Simulation Tools
Compared to other popular flight sims, such as X-Plane or Aerofly, Microsoft Flight Simulator's emphasis on global landscape accuracy and real-time data integration gives it a distinct advantage. Its capacity to simulate cloud cover, atmospheric conditions, and real-world time zones offers a level of immersion akin to an actual pilot's daily routine, pushing the boundaries of consumer flight simulation. Furthermore, for those interested in pilot training or geographical visualization, its transferability and realism make it a compelling choice over more arcade-style alternatives.

Frequently Asked Questions
How do I get started with setting up Microsoft Flight Simulator (2020) Premium Deluxe Edition?
Download and install the game via the Microsoft Store or Xbox app, then follow the beginner tutorial prompts for initial setup and controls calibration.
Can I customize my aircraft and scenery in the game?
Yes, access the Content Manager from the main menu to download, customize aircraft, and adjust scenery settings as desired.
What are the main differences between the Standard, Deluxe, and Premium Deluxe editions?
The Premium Deluxe includes all Deluxe content plus 5 additional aircraft, 5 international airports, and 24 classic missions for an enhanced experience.
How do I access and switch between real-time weather and regular weather modes?
Navigate to 'General Settings' > 'Weather' and select 'Live Weather' for real-time conditions or manual options for custom weather.
What features help me practice pilot skills and navigation?
Use the Checklist System for instrument guidance, and explore missions or free flight modes to practice various flying scenarios.
How can I learn more about operating specific aircraft like the Boeing 787 or helicopters?
Fly in cockpit view and refer to in-game interactive checklists and tutorials for detailed guidance on each aircraft's operation.
Are there any subscription or additional costs beyond purchasing the game?
The Premium Deluxe features are included in your purchase; there are no ongoing subscriptions, but optional add-ons or scenery packs are available.
What should I do if the game crashes or I encounter performance issues?
Ensure your system meets the requirements, update your graphics drivers, and verify game files via the game launcher's troubleshooting options.
Can I experience night flights or extreme weather conditions?
Yes, the game offers day/night cycle and live weather modes to simulate night flights and various atmospheric conditions.
Does the app support multiplayer or live traffic features?
Yes, the live world features include real-time traffic, dynamic weather, animals, and multiplayer interactions through online connectivity.
